Fifty years have passed since the public storm that accompanied “I am Ahmad” (1965), directed by Avshalom Katz and produced by Ram Levi. Israeli documentary film, and exposed the racism towards Israeli Arab citizens ~

The Sam Spiegel Film School has been working consistently in recent years to relate retrospectively to the short films of Israeli cinema from the 1960s, the design years of Israeli cinema,

The third installment of the adult trilogy, “Ahmed’s Voice,” is a feature-length feature film made up of six short films of adults and adults, Jews and Arabs, examining Ahmed’s place in the complex contemporary Israeli reality. A film that looks at racism today and about utopia in Helsinki ~
